
Al Azhar Grand Imam and Chairman of the Muslim Council of Elders (MCE) Dr. Ahmed el Tayyeb opened on Tuesday the second international forum entitled "East and West: Dialogue of Civilizations".
Tayyeb took part in the first forum that was organized by the Catholic Community of Sant'Egidio and held in June 2015 in Italy's Florence city.
The gathering is attended by Paris mayor Anne Hidalgo, Founder of the Catholic Community of Sant'Egidio Andrea Riccardi, MCE Secretary General Ali al Nuaimi and President of the Protestant Federation of France François Clavairoly.
Ex-awqaf minister and MCE member Mahmoud Hamdi Zaqzouq will head a seminar, under the theme "East and West in front of globalization".
On Monday, Tayyeb arrived in Paris on his first official visit to France, coming from Italy within the framework of his current European tour.
